Speeding Car Goes Airborne In Wichita, Killing 2

WICHITA (AP) – Two men are dead after a speeding car struck a culvert and went airborne in the western part of Wichita.

The Wichita Eagle reports that the car struck a power pole and utility lines before landing early Thursday.

Wichita police Capt. John Speer says the 21-year-old driver died at the scene. His 22-year-old passenger was thrown from the vehicle and died at a Wichita hospital.

The names of the victims weren’t immediately released.

Authorities are investigating the cause of the crash. At least one witness recalled seeing the car speeding beforehand.
